We’re absolutely delighted to announce that we’ve received funding from the incredible supporting community fund from Wigan Counci to launch some incredible community projects right here in Wigan helping local women get moving, get talking and feel more connected through movement.
And we’re kicking things off with our Over 50s Friendly Nordic Walking Taster Session at Haigh Hall! 🌳

This is about so much more than going for a walk.
It’s a chance to get outdoors, gently increase your activity, meet other local women, have a chat, enjoy some fresh air and discover a fun new way to move all in a friendly, supportive and completely pressure-free environment.

✨ Never tried Nordic Walking? Perfect.
✨ Haven’t exercised for a while? You’re welcome.
✨ Coming on your own? Absolutely!
✨ Worried about fitness levels? Don’t be we’ll take it at a comfortable pace.
✨ No equipment? We’ve got you covered Nordic Walking poles are provided but you can bring your own if you have them too.

We want to create more opportunities in Wigan for women over 50 to move, connect, make new friendships and feel part of something in their local community.
